Take for example the newly premiering episode titled “The High Cost of Cool”. In that installment, Drew and Jonathan help former downtown-condo dwellers Derek and Christine in their quest for a home of their own – one with a decidedly modern aesthetic.

Photo by Darren Goldstein/DSG Photo.

Photo by Darren Goldstein/DSG Photo.

After looking at 90 houses, and missing out on several offers, Derek and Christine are feeling discouraged. They’re looking for ample space, a midcentury feel and a killer kitchen. After Drew and Jonathan present them with some distinct options, the upshot eventually is a suburban home that, after being substantially customized a la the Bros, boasts an impressive living space with a statement fireplace, impressive sight-lines, high ceilings and an open concept kitchen. And, importantly, a healthy dose of cool.
